Real Madrid have decided their top targets for next summer and it will make them the most frightening team in world football

Los Blancos president Florentino Perez has 'prioritised' signing one of the world's best midfielders.

Real Madrid are plotting a move for not just one, but two big-name players in 2025 as they continue to build one of the most feared teams in football.

Los Blancos president Florentino Perez is said to be 'pulling out all the stops' to sign one of the world's best defensive midfielders.

Perez has reportedly instructed his recruitment team to do 'everything possible' to get Manchester City's Rodri on board next summer, according to Football Transfers.

The 28-year-old, who has three years remaining on his current contract, is understood to be interested in a move back to Spain and the prospect will be 'taken seriously', adds the report.

That being said, Manchester City are prepared to make Rodri one of the best-paid players at the club after becoming an integral member of Pep Guardiola's side in recent years.

As well as Rodri, the Spanish giants are also keen on bringing Bayer Leverkusen playmaker Florian Wirtz to the Bernabeu in 2025.

Wirtz helped Xabi Alonso's side to a historic unbeaten run in the Bundesliga last season, and was named the league's Player of the Season after notching 11 goals and 12 assists.

The 21-year-old, who is also attracting interest from Bayern Munich, would later become one of Germany's standout performers at Euro 2024.

In fact, Real Madrid will try and sign the player next summer if the opportunity presents itself, according to Relevo, who say Los Blancos seem 'well positioned' to make a move.

The playmaker is considered by Madrid as a 'great option' to improve their already-stacked midfield

This summer, it was Kylian Mbappe who was Florentino Perez's annual galactico signing.

"I want to thank the president [Florentino Pérez] first," the Frenchman said in his transfer presentation at the Bernabeu.

"He believed in me from the first day. A lot of things happened, but I want to say thank you. I want to thank everyone who has worked for me to come here. I know it was hard but now I'm here, I'm a Real Madrid player.

"Since I was a kid I had one dream, to play here. Being here means a lot to me ... Now I want to achieve another dream, being at the level of this club, the best in the world. I can say one thing: I'll give everything for this club and this badge.
